Dictionary-Guided Mutation Operators for Automated HDL Repair

The paper introduces a dictionary-guided HDL repair system that uses ANTLR-derived mutation vocabularies and a simulation-divergence fault localization module to generate syntactically valid Verilog mutations. The mutation operator performs token substitutions, insertions, and deletions via regex matching, while the fault localization scores source lines based on proximity to diverging output wires, guiding the search. Evaluated on the CirFix benchmark, the approach achieves correct repairs on 14 bug variants, including a multi-bug case, and outperforms CirFix with an 18x speedup on a two-edit benchmark.
